Accretive Technology Group | Lively Video – Product Marketing Manager

Work Remotely From: Arizona, California, Colorado, Florida, Michigan, Missouri, Nevada, South Carolina, Texas, or Washington.

Company Overview: We are a Seattle-based tech company with over 25 years of proven success. Privately owned, stable, and profitable, we've built our reputation on open-source values, a strong DIY spirit, and a deep respect for craftsmanship. As a market leader in web-based live video streaming, we’re expanding our teams with passionate, empowered individuals who take pride in their work. 

ATG's R&D Department, Lively Video, has a specialized division that is at the forefront of redefining online privacy, identity, and safety through innovative technologies such as AI and blockchain. Our mission is to make online identity more secure, private, and protected. Think of us as an R&D group within an R&D group, constantly pushing the boundaries of what's possible in the digital world to ensure a safer and more private online experience.

About the Role: We operate with a lean, startup mindset and are looking for a hands-on product marketing manager to elevate our brand presence and drive inbound interest. The role will evolve and expand as the company grows, offering strong potential for advancement.

Key Objectives:

  • Overhaul website messaging and user flows for both product brands
  • Launch and maintain regular, high-quality blog and website content to build inbound leads (SEO, conversion funnels)
  • Professionalize our overall brand, bringing websites and communications up to par with trusted, mature startups
  • Establish and manage inbound marketing processes using AI and automation tools

Ideal Profile:

  • 4+ years of experience in SaaS product marketing, ideally in a startup or resource-constrained environment
  • Semi-technical: understands how to use AI tools to multiply output and produce expert content efficiently (not a deep technical writer, but AI-literate)
  • Hands-on with marketing automation, Google Analytics, and AI content tools; Mixpanel is a plus
  • Practical skills in Webflow (or similar), Figma, and basic image editing
  • Self-starter, autonomous, thrives with minimal direction and budget
  • Prioritizes inbound/content/brand over outbound sales

Key Intangibles:

  • Scrappy, “builder” mentality
  • Able to manage and professionalize communication for multiple brands
  • Brings a fresh, modern approach to SaaS marketing
